Cell line name SICH
Synonyms Sahul Indian Catla Heart
Accession CVCL_R811
Resource Identification Initiative To cite this cell line use: SICH (RRID:CVCL_R811)
Comments Group: Fish cell line.
Registration: National Repository of Fish Cell Line (NRFC), National Bureau of Fish Genetic Resources, India; NRFC019.
Derived from site: In situ; Heart; UBERON=UBERON_0000948.
Species of origin Labeo catla (Catla) (Catla catla) (NCBI Taxonomy: 72446)
Sex of cell Sex unspecified
Age at sampling Age unspecified
Category Spontaneously immortalized cell line
